• 제목/요약/키워드: 3D Computer Animation

검색결과 235건 처리시간 0.026초

선형 컨벌루션과 경계구를 이용한 물표면과 객체의 실시간 상호작용 생성 (Interaction between Water Surface and 3D Object by using Linear Convolution and Bounding Sphere)

  • 강경헌;이현철;허기택;김은석
    • 한국콘텐츠학회논문지
    • /
    • 제8권4호
    • /
    • pp.17-29
    • /
    • 2008
  • 컴퓨터 그래픽스에서 물을 애니메이션하거나 다양한 특수효과를 표현하기위해 유체역학의 기술들이 사용되고 있다. 하드웨어성능이 높아지면서 이전에 불가능했던 알고리즘들이 실시간으로 가능해지고 있기는 하지만, 정밀한 표현에는 여전히 많은 시간이 소요되며, 성능과 사실성 사이의 균형을 위한 다양한 기술들이 연구되고 있다. 특히 게임과 같은 문맥을 가지는 곳에서 사용자의 요구에 의해 바다나 호수 같은 넓은 지역의 물표면과 객체의 상호작용을 표현하기 위해서는, 물리적 사실성을 어느 정도 희생하더라도 시각적인 사실성을 유지하는 범위에서 실행 성능을 높이는 것이 우선시 된다. 본 논문에서는 물표면과 객체의 상호작용에 의한 다양한 물표면의 형태변화를 선형 컨벌루션 기법과 경계구를 이용하여 실시간으로 자연스럽게 애니메이션하는 방법을 제안한다.

3차원 입체영상에서 시지각(時知覺) 요인의 상관관계 (A Study on the Correlation of Factors in 3-D Stereoscopic Visual-perception)

  • 조용근
    • 만화애니메이션 연구
    • /
    • 통권19호
    • /
    • pp.161-181
    • /
    • 2010
  • 인간이 외부세계를 지각하는데 70%이상을 의존하고 시각을 통한 지각경험은 3차원 입체 영상기술의 발전으로 실재감 재현의 주축이 되고 있으며 다양한 연구 분야의 접목을 통해 발전하고 있다. 3차원 입체지각 기술은 양안시차의 지각요인의 원리를 경험적 지각요인과 결합하여 실재감을 재현하는 기술로, 인간이 지닌 시각의 생리적 특징을 메카니즘으로 한 것이다. 하지만 인간의 지각요인은 생리적인 요인으로만 설명하기엔 부족함이 많다. 대상을 지각하는데 있어 일정하게 지각하는 것이 아니라 인간의 심리적인 요인이나 물리적인 상태에 따라 다양하게 인지된다는 특성이 있기 때문이다. 따라서 시지각 요인간의 상관관계가 3차원 입체지각에 영향을 미치는지를 프로토타입을 제작하여 검증하고자 한다. 특히 3차원 입체를 지각하는 경험적, 생리적 요인과 형태를 지각하는 물리적, 심리적 요인을 중심으로, 게슈탈트의 집단화 및 단순화 현상과 3차원 입체지각 간의 관계를 실험을 통해 살펴볼 것이다. 본 연구를 통해 3차원 입체의 지각특성을 을 일부 파악하고 이는 실재감 재현을 위한 3차원 입체 콘텐츠제작에 기초연구가 될 것으로 본다.

  • PDF

PC 환경에서의 3인칭 액션게임 설계 (Design of 3D Action Game for PC Environment)

  • 안성옥;이희범;박동원;김수균;정진영
    • 한국컴퓨터정보학회논문지
    • /
    • 제19권4호
    • /
    • pp.63-69
    • /
    • 2014
  • 3인칭 액션게임은 많은 마니아층의 사용자들에게 지속적인 관심을 받고 있는 장르이다. 이러한 3인칭 액션게임은 사용자가 캐릭터의 모습과 다양한 액션을 볼 수 있게 하여 게임에 대한 몰입도를 높일 수 있는 특징을 가지고 있다. 많은 장르의 게임들이 게임엔진을 사용하여 제작되고 있지만, 본 논문에서는 게임엔진의 특정화된 기술을 사용하지 않고, 단지 DirectX 라이브러리를 이용하여 3인칭 액션 게임을 설계하여 게임 개발에 들어가는 비용을 최소화 할 수 있다는 장점을 가지고 있다. 또한 본 논문에서는 여러 가지 기본 알고리즘을 이용하여 다양한 이벤트 처리와 애니메이션 효과를 좀 더 효율적인 방법으로 그래픽 디바이스에서 빠르게 처리하도록 한다. 성능에 대한 우수성은 게임의 실험 결과에서 잘 나타낸다.

게임엔진 활용으로 게임 그래픽 교육 효율성 제고: 유니티3D(Unity3D)와 토크(Torque) 엔진을 중심으로 (The raise the efficiency of game graphics design education using game engine : In focus of Unity3D and Torque)

  • 김치훈;박성일
    • 만화애니메이션 연구
    • /
    • 통권29호
    • /
    • pp.151-172
    • /
    • 2012
  • 대학의 게임제작교육은 게임교육 과정의 완성단계이며 게임 산업의 미래를 결정하기 때문에 매우 중요하다. 그러므로 다양한 제작 경험과 창작학습을 수행하기 위해서 현재 게임 산업의 진행 방향과 정보통신의 나아갈 방향을 미리 예단하여 게임제작에 필요한 정보를 습득 재가공하는 것이 필요하다. 본 연구는 게임 그래픽 디자이너 지망생을 위한 게임엔진 교육의 효율적 방안에 초점을 맞추었다. 이들을 대상으로 게임 엔진 기반의 제작 수업을 진행하여 실무 중심의 게임 제작 능력을 가능하게 하는 방법론을 제시하는 것이다. 게임제작 수업 시간에 그래픽 지향의 학생이 가상의 게임을 기획하고 결과물을 그래픽 작업만으로 제한하는 것이 아니라 그래픽 데이터를 검증하고 보완점을 찾아 완성도 높은 기획과 그래픽 능력을 갖추는 것을 말한다. 그러나 게임 프로그래머의 도움 없이는 불가능한 작업이기에 게임 엔진 교육의 중요성이 대두된다. 연구 내용에는 국내 게임 교육기관의 애로사항을 파악하고 그래픽 디자이너 중심의 편한 환경을 제공하는 게임엔진인 유니티3D(Unity3D)와 프로그래머 중심의 토크(Torque) 엔진을 기반으로 게임엔진을 활용한 제작 사례를 제시한다. 또한 본 연구의 목적과 학습 효율을 알아보기 위해 제작 이후 설문방식을 통해 게임 엔진의 활용이 게임 그래픽 교육에 효율성이 있는지 알아본다. 이를 통해 게임프로그래밍 비전공자들의 경우 기획서 작성에만 머물고 실제의 게임제작 구현이 불가능했던 수업을 개선할 수 있을 것으로 기대한다.

가는 막대의 물리기반 실시간 시뮬레이션 (Physics-Based Real-Time Simulation of Thin Rods)

  • 최민규
    • 한국컴퓨터그래픽스학회논문지
    • /
    • 제16권2호
    • /
    • pp.1-7
    • /
    • 2010
  • 본 논문에서는 큰 회전 변형이 일어나는 가는 막대를 실시간에 시뮬레이션하는 기법을 제안한다. 가는 막대는 로프나 머리카락과 같이 일차원적인 구조를 표현하는데 널리 사용될 수 있다. 시각적으로 사실적인 가는 막대의 애니메이션을 실시간에 생성하는 것은 컴퓨터 그래픽스분야에서 오랫동안 주요한 도전 과제였다. 본 논문에서는 연속체 역학에 기반한 지배방정식을 세우고 이를 실시간에 적분하는 가는 막대구조를 위한 모달와핑기법을 개발한다. 이와같은 새로운 시뮬레이션 기법은 삼차원 솔리드를 위해 개발된 종전의 모달 와핑 기법을 확장한 것이다. 본 논문에서 제안한 방법은 매우 많은 정점으로 이루어진 가는 막대 구조의 큰 휨과 꼬임변형도 실시간에 사실적으로 생성할 수 있다.

영상 콘텐츠에서 카툰 렌더링기법의 활용 (Expression of Cartoon Rendering Method in Image Contents)

  • 김종서;곽훈성
    • 한국콘텐츠학회논문지
    • /
    • 제7권8호
    • /
    • pp.142-151
    • /
    • 2007
  • 3D 컴퓨터 그래픽스의 비약적 발전으로 전통적인 셀 애니메이션은 여러 가지 디지털 기법으로 표현되고 끊임없는 다양한 시도를 통하여 그 영역을 확대해 나가고 있다. 우리가 표현하는 렌더링 기법에는 사진과 같은 정확한 영상을 구현하는 사실적 렌더링(Photorealistic rendering)기법과, 사람의 감성과 예술성이 표현되는 비사실적 렌더링(NPR: Non-Photorealistic rendering)기법으로 크게 구분된다. 본 논문에서는 비사실적 렌더링(NPR)기법에서 사용되는 여러 기법 중 카툰 렌더링(cartoon rendering)기법의 활용에 대하여 살펴보았다. 영상 컨텐츠 가운데 최근의 영화와 게임 그리고 광고 분야에서 사용된 카툰 렌더링기법에 대하여 각각의 제작 사례에 대한 분석과 특징을 조사하였다. 이러한 연구를 통해 최근의 카툰 렌더링 기법의 적용성과 장단점을 파악하여 좀 더 감성적이고 친근하며 완성도 높은 작품을 제작 할 수 있도록 한다.

웹을 이용한 실시간 소성가공의 해석에 관한 연구 (A Study on the Real Time Analysis of Plastic Deformation Process using WWW(World Wide Web))

  • 이상돈;최호준;방세윤;임중연;이호용
    • 소성∙가공
    • /
    • 제12권2호
    • /
    • pp.110-115
    • /
    • 2003
  • This paper is concerned with the compression test and forming process of flange by using virtual reality and analysis(simulation) program. This virtual manufacturing can be carried out one personal computer without any expensive devices for experiment. The virtual manufacturing composed of three modules such as the imput, calculation and the output modules on internet. Internet user can give the material's property and process parameters to the sever computer at the input module. On the calculation module, a simulator computes the virtual manufacturing process by analysis program and stores the data as a file. The output module is the program in which internet user can confirm virtual manufacturing results by showing tables, graphs, and 3D animation. This programs is designed by an internet language such as HTML, CGI, VRML and JAVA ,while analysis programs use the finite increasing, the virtual manufacturing technique will substitute many real experiments in the future.

어류의 역동적 움직임 표현을 위한 기준점 적용 보간법 (Pivot Interpolation for Dynamic Locomotion Expression of Fishes)

  • 류남훈;이혜미;유봉길;김응곤
    • 한국전자통신학회논문지
    • /
    • 제5권5호
    • /
    • pp.415-420
    • /
    • 2010
  • PC 성능의 향상 및 컴퓨터 그래픽스 기술의 발달로 인해 사회 각 분야에서 고품질의 컴퓨터 애니메이션이 점차 증가하고 있다. 본 연구에서는 해저의 풍경을 표현함에 있어 가장 핵심이 되는 어류 객체의 역동적이고 자연스러운 움직임을 표현하는 과정을 모핑 기법을 통하여 구현하기 위한 기준점 적용 보간법을 제안한다. 어류 객체의 꼬리 움직임에 적용시킴으로써 기존 모핑 기법이 가지고 있던 부자연스러운 속도감을 해결하고, 단조로운 움직임을 탈피한 현실감 있는 유영 방식을 구현한다.

한국 방송에서 초기 컴퓨터 활용에 관한 연구: 선거 개표방송 변천사를 중심으로(1985년-1992년) (A Study on the Early Computer Utilization in Korean Broadcasting: Focusing on the History of Election Broadcasting(1985-1992))

  • 나소미
    • 디지털융복합연구
    • /
    • 제20권1호
    • /
    • pp.301-307
    • /
    • 2022
  • 오늘날 각 방송사는 선거방송에서 최신 기술인 CG(computer Graphics)를 최대한 사용하여 시청자의 눈을 사로잡으려고 경쟁한다. 이 논문은 CG디자이너의 관점에서 선거 개표방송 내의 CG 기술과 디자인의 변천사를 조사하였다. 컴퓨터를 활용하여 선거 개표방송을 시작한 1980년대부터 가상스튜디오가 본격적으로 활용되기 전까지, 총선, 대선, 지방선거의 개표방송 영상을 시청하면서 CG로 제작한 이미지 부분과 기술의 활용을 다각도로 분석하였다. 국내에서는 자체 개발한 EDDS(Election Data Display System)부터 시작하여, 컴퓨터를 이용하여 데이터베이스화를 하였고, 그 시기부터 일일이 수작업한 애니메이션 CG를 도입하였다. 이후 방송사는 다양하고 화려한 CG 이미지 경쟁에 초점을 맞추었고, CG 이미지는 기술과 디자인이 함께 발전하면서, 2차원에서 3차원으로 확장되었다. 한국 방송은 1985년부터 1992년 사이에 디지털 기술을 활용하면서, 정보력에 중점을 두었던 것에서 이미지로 변화하는 과도기라고 볼 수 있다.

온라인 3D 게임엔진 개발에 관한 연구 (A Study on Development of an On-line 3D Game Engine)

  • 이헌주;박태준;김현빈
    • 한국게임학회 논문지
    • /
    • 제3권2호
    • /
    • pp.42-55
    • /
    • 2003
  • 국내의 온라인 2D 게임 개발 능력은 국제적으로 강한 경쟁력을 확보하고 있으나, 온라인 3D 게임 분야에서는 자본력과 기술력의 한계로 세계 시장에서 경쟁력 우위의 지속적인 유지가 어려운 상황이다. 본 연구에서 제안하고자 하는 온라인 3D 게임 엔진 제반 기술은 외국의 업체에 비해 상대적으로 열세에 놓인 국내 게임 개발업체에 게임 엔진 기술을 제공하여 세계적인 게임 경쟁력을 확보할 수 있도록 하는 것을 목적으로 한다. 이를 위하여 본 연구에서는 최신 기술동향을 반영한 3D 온라인게임 제작용 엔진을 위한 핵심 기술을 개발하였다. 제안된 게임엔진은 게임환경을 구성하고 시각화할 수 있는 렌더링 기술, 애니메이션 기술을 통합하고 보다 안정적인 온라인 서비스가 가능한 서버 기능을 제공한다.

  • PDF